DescriptionPresents the 130 recipes, covering various types of dishes (from antipasti to desserts, from first courses to pizzas and focaccias, and on to second course dishes of meat and fish), and helping the reader savour the many expressions of Mediterranean cuisine. Author descriptionAcademia Barilla is the first international center dedicated to the promotion and development of Italian Gastronomic Culture in the world. In order to achieve this objective, it puts into action a daily commitment in appraising the wealth of Italian products and sustaining research into its own services which are of a very high standard of quality. |
